HELP! Mac G4 Finder flashes off and on, files close
My sturdy mac G4 running OSX 10.4.11 has developed a weird thing where the finder flashes off and on, the files flash off all together as if someone was resetting the finder. I ran disk warrior and utilities but still doing the same thing. Any suggestions? Never had virus. Whaats up?
Hi greenteam, and a warm welcome to the forums!
It's likely some 3rd Party APP that got broken by the recent QT or Security update.
Stuffit AVR has been a big one, if you have that use the Pref Pane to turn it off, but others have been implicated too. Check System Preferences for a Stuffit Pref Pane and disable AVR.
One way to test is to Safe Boot from the HD, (holding Shift key down at bootup), run Disk Utility in Applications>Utilities, then highlight your drive, click on Repair Permissions, Test for action in Safe Mode...
Reboot, test again.
If it only does it in Regular Boot, then it is some 3rd party add-on, Check System Preferences>Accounts>Login Items window to see if it or something relevant is listed.
Check the System Preferences>Other Row, for 3rd party Pref Panes.
Also look in these if they exist, some are invisible...
/private/var/run/StartupItems
/Library/StartupItems
/System/Library/StartupItems

Hard Drive icon won't open and menu bar flashes off and on
All of a sudden, in the middle of the day, my eMac went haywire. I can launch apps and docs are one the desktop. But I cannot open the Hard Drive icon. If I double-click on it (or used Command-O from keyboard), the icon won't open. And when I attempt to open it, the Finder Menu Bar begins flashing off and on (vanishing, reappearing, vanishing) across the top of the screen. I haver rebooted, run disk utility to repair permissions, even booted from TechTools to run its diagnostics. But still no access to the Hard Drive icon. I logged out and logged in as a TEST user, and same thing happens even when logged in that way. Literally, this happened in an instant. One minute the eMac was fine, then this started. Anyone else seen this? -- david
If the problem exists in both your regular account and your Test account odds are that it is at the system level. You can try a Safe boot (hold down the shift key at startup) to see if there is a third party startup item or one of the optional Apple functions that is causing the problem. You could also boot from the installer disk and use the Disk Utility->Repair Disk function. If you have a utility such as Tiger Cache Cleaner which will do a deep cache clean you can also try that.

My Mac won't install mpkg and pkg files.
My Mac won't install mpkg and pkg files. Whenever I double-click an pkg or mpkg file, I get the dialog box to "choose an application" to open it. After some searching, I discovered I do not have the installer.app. I tried to Repair Disk from my Snow Leopard DVD but every time it boots from the DVD, my computer crashes. Any suggestions?
You have the installer app. It is located in /System/Library/CoreServices.
Use the finder's Go menu, Go to Folder... and type /System/Library/CoreServices to open the CoreServices folder. You should see it in there. If you do not see it there then that would beg the question what else might be missing and perphas you need to do an update (re)install (or restore form a hopefully good backup).
To try to reassoicatate .[m]pkl's with the Installer, take one of your .[m]pkg's and do a finder Get Info on it and set the Open with... to the Installer app. If the Installer app is not shown use Other... at the bottom of the list to navigate to the CoreServices folder and select Installer. Then click the Change All... button.
I am not sure why your [.m]pkgs would have lost their Launch Services association with Installer in the first place (unless it really is missing). -
